Set on a generous 692sqm green-title block in a quiet cul-de-sac, this versatile family home delivers an outstanding combination of space, flexibility and future potential in one of Stirling's most tightly held pockets. Offering a well-designed main residence plus a fully self-contained granny flat under the same roofline, the property is perfectly suited to large families, multi-generational living, teenagers seeking independence or buyers looking for additional rental income opportunities.

Beyond the double door entry, the home welcomes you with a light-filled formal lounge overlooking the peaceful streetscape, flowing through to a separate formal dining room or home office. At the heart of the home, the renovated open-plan kitchen, living and meals area provides a practical and inviting space for everyday living, complete with ample bench space, generous storage, gas cooking and quality appliances.

The accommodation within the main home includes a spacious master suite with built-in robes and updated ensuite, while the secondary bedrooms are serviced by a modernised family bathroom. A cleverly positioned third bedroom acts as a flexible connection point between the main residence and granny flat, allowing the layout to adapt to your family's changing needs.

Privately positioned with its own separate access, the granny flat offers a fully functional open-plan kitchen, living and dining area, a large bedroom with extensive robe space, plus an ensuite bathroom with integrated laundry facilities. Whether accommodating extended family, guests or tenants, this space offers excellent independence and privacy.

Outdoors, the low-maintenance backyard provides plenty of room for entertaining, additional parking or secure storage for boats, caravans, trailers and extra vehicles. Side access leads through to the huge powered workshop with double remote access doors, creating the ultimate setup for tradies, hobbyists, car enthusiasts or those simply needing extra storage space.

Positioned within walking distance to local parks and reserves, and close to quality schools, shopping centres, public transport and freeway access, this is a rare opportunity to secure a substantial and adaptable home in a highly convenient location just minutes from the coast and Perth CBD.
